Types of BMW Keys and Their Replacement Considerations

BMW produces a number of distinct crucial types, each with unique replacement treatments and cost implications. Understanding which key type your automobile utilizes is important before seeking replacement services.

Requirement Remote Keys represent the most typical type discovered in BMW vehicles. These keys combine a conventional metal blade with a remote fob containing buttons for locking, unlocking, and trunk release. The internal transponder chip need to be set to match your car's security system, requiring specific equipment that most locksmiths and dealers have.

Convenience Access Keys remove the need to physically push buttons, permitting owners to lock, unlock, and start their vehicles simply by having the type in their possession. These keys contain more complex electronic devices and extra sensing units, making their replacement more costly and technically requiring than standard remote keys.

Display Keys available on more recent BMW models include a little LCD screen that displays lorry status info, consisting of fuel level, maintenance reminders, and environment control settings. These superior keys incorporate touch-sensitive technology and require manufacturer-level programming equipment, limiting replacement choices mainly to authorized dealers.

The BMW Key Cutting Process

The crucial cutting process for BMW vehicles includes two distinct stages that should both be completed successfully to produce a functional replacement. The very first phase addresses the physical blade that inserts into the ignition cylinder or door lock, while the 2nd stage manages the electronic programs that allows interaction in between the secret and your automobile's security system.

Physical crucial cutting requires an accuracy essential cutting maker and the appropriate essential blank for your particular BMW model and year. BMW utilizes various key blank styles across its model range, and using an inaccurate blank can lead to a key that physically stops working to run the locks. Expert key cutting services preserve comprehensive blank stocks or can purchase blanks specific to your automobile within a brief timeframe.

Electronic programs represents the more complex element of BMW essential replacement. This procedure includes linking specialized diagnostic devices to your car's onboard computer system to register the new secret's special electronic signature. BMW's security procedures are intentionally robust, preventing unapproved essential duplication and protecting lorry theft. This security step, while outstanding for vehicle security, implies that shows typically needs access to BMW's secure servers or exclusive diagnostic tools.

Cost Factors and Considerations

The cost of BMW key replacement differs considerably based on a number of aspects that every BMW owner ought to comprehend before requesting service. The type of secret, the automobile's design year, and the company all influence the last rate significantly.

Key type represents the main expense factor. A basic BMW secret blank with basic shows typically costs between ₤ 150 and ₤ 300 when serviced through a car dealership. More advanced Comfort Access keys with push-button start performance often range from ₤ 250 to ₤ 450. Show keys found on premium BMW designs can exceed ₤ 500 or even technique ₤ 1,000 when replaced through official channels.

Service service provider option likewise affects prices substantially. BMW dealerships use manufacturer-backed service with guaranteed compatibility and professional programs, however their rates show the overhead of franchise operations. Third-party automobile locksmith professionals focusing on European lorries can typically offer crucial cutting and programming services at lower costs, though validating their devices capabilities and reputation is essential before devoting to the service.

Car age impacts both parts availability and shows requirements. Older BMW designs typically have more budget-friendly replacement keys because the technology is less advanced and extra parts remain more readily offered. Newer vehicles with the current security functions might need more expensive equipment to program and might require dealership service for particular functions.

Why is BMW key replacement so expensive compared to other car brands?

BMW crucial replacement expenses show the advanced technology integrated into each key and the security determines securing automobile gain access to. BMW keys contain encrypted transponders, and in most cases, need programs through BMW's protected servers. The devices needed to perform this programming represents a substantial investment, costs that provider recover through their prices. In addition, BMW's dedication to vehicle security implies keys can not be easily duplicated without correct authorization and equipment.

Safeguarding Your BMW Key Investment

Preventive measures can help BMW owners avoid the expenditure and trouble of emergency key replacement. Keeping a spare crucial stored in a safe but available location supplies immediate backup if the main key is lost or harmed. Some owners select to keep a spare key with a trusted relative or friend, while others preserve a safe and secure key box or safe in the house for this function.

Routinely examining your BMW key for wear or damage allows you to deal with issues before total failure occurs. Signs of crucial malfunction consist of buttons ending up being unresponsive, the crucial blade needing extreme force to turn, or the car intermittently failing to acknowledge the key's existence. Dealing with these indication without delay through crucial examination or professional examination can avoid being stranded with a non-functional key.

Finally, keeping records of your essential code and automobile recognition number facilitates faster replacement if the requirement develops. This information, usually discovered in your vehicle documents and on the essential itself, streamlines the buying and configuring procedure substantially.
